dc.description.abstract | newline This study analyses a person on the basis of physical actions, food preferences, newlineway of seeing, inclination for walking, standing, laying and sitting, etc. It classifies newlinea person into six basic caritas and their behavior patterns are termed as cariyas. newlineChallenges and essentials in the time of the Buddha were not as complex as they are newlinetoday. His teachings have huge influence on social configuration, administrative newlineorders, education and empowerment, morality, thoughts, thinkers and belief system. newlineThe world has changed very fast. The very basic foundations of the teachings - sila, samadhi and panna are also under the existential crisis due to Artificial Intelligence newline(AI). | |
